Lando Norris has been a consistent podium finisher this year, yet he admits not feeling at his best. Leading the World Drivers’ Championship, Norris reveals a struggle with the McLaren MCL39, finding it hard to hit his stride. Despite podium success, something feels amiss for the young driver.
In Bahrain, Norris faced his toughest race yet, starting from P6 and concluding at a commendable P3. This occurred while teammate Oscar Piastri effortlessly soared to victory. Norris, 25, known for his introspective nature, admits to feeling a disconnect with the car, a stark contrast from last season’s confidence.
Norris’ Bahrain Struggle
In Bahrain, Lando Norris grappled with an unusually tough race, culminating in a P3 finish despite a breach at the start. His teammate Oscar Piastri, without hiccups, clinched the top spot. Norris, often critical of his performance, spoke openly about the difficulties he’s facing, saying, “Something was just not clicking.”
Norris expressed frustration over not being able to perform at last year’s level, mentioning that everything from last season felt intuitive and seamless. This year, however, presents a stark contrast with its complexities. The car seems to be a puzzle missing crucial pieces, affecting Norris’ confidence during races.
Piastri’s Smooth Journey
Oscar Piastri’s experience with the McLaren MCL39 seems markedly different. Dominating the race, he completed 15.499 seconds ahead with ease. Piastri finds the car’s pace highly satisfactory, even though the initial tests indicated areas needing improvement.
Piastri asserted that the team had successfully addressed early concerns, thus feeling comfortable and confident, particularly during the Bahrain GP. There’s a clear sense of satisfaction in Piastri’s remarks about his experience with the car, starkly contrasting with Norris’ struggles.
